Skip to content

Cart

Your cart is empty

Barbour Alder Leather Tote Bag | Brown

Sale price£139.30 Regular price£199.00
Size:

Size

Barbour Alder Leather Tote Bag | Brown
Barbour Alder Leather Tote Bag | Brown Sale price£139.30 Regular price£199.00

Recently viewed